1993 Mercury Capri vs. 2001 Tata Safari

To start off, 2001 Tata Safari is newer by 8 year(s). Which means there will be less support and parts availability for 1993 Mercury Capri. In addition, the cost of maintenance, including insurance, on 1993 Mercury Capri would be higher. At 1,948 cc (4 cylinders), 2001 Tata Safari is equipped with a bigger engine. In terms of performance, 2001 Tata Safari (135 HP @ 5530 RPM) has 35 more horse power than 1993 Mercury Capri. (100 HP @ 5750 RPM) In normal driving conditions, 2001 Tata Safari should accelerate faster than 1993 Mercury Capri. With that said, vehicle weight also plays an important factor in acceleration. 2001 Tata Safari weights approximately 954 kg more than 1993 Mercury Capri. So despite on having greater horse power, its additional weight may have an impact towards its acceleration in comparison.

Because 2001 Tata Safari is four wheel drive (4WD), it will have significant more traction and grip than 1993 Mercury Capri. In wet, icy, snow, or gravel driving conditions, 2001 Tata Safari will offer significantly more control. With that said, do keep in mind that many other factors such as speed and the wear on your tires can also have significant impact on traction and control. Let's talk about torque, 2001 Tata Safari (181 Nm @ 4500 RPM) has 51 more torque (in Nm) than 1993 Mercury Capri. (130 Nm @ 5500 RPM). This means 2001 Tata Safari will have an easier job in driving up hills or pulling heavy equipment than 1993 Mercury Capri.

Compare all specifications:

1993 Mercury Capri 2001 Tata Safari
Make Mercury Tata
Model Capri Safari
Year Released 1993 2001
Engine Position Front Front
Engine Size 1598 cc 1948 cc
Engine Cylinders 4 cylinders 4 cylinders
Engine Type in-line in-line
Horse Power 100 HP 135 HP
Engine RPM 5750 RPM 5530 RPM
Torque 130 Nm 181 Nm
Torque RPM 5500 RPM 4500 RPM
Fuel Type Gasoline Gasoline
Drive Type Front 4WD
Vehicle Weight 1086 kg 2040 kg
Vehicle Length 4230 mm 4660 mm
Vehicle Width 1650 mm 1820 mm
Vehicle Height 1290 mm 1930 mm
Wheelbase Size 2410 mm 2660 mm
